About This Home
Experience exceptional living with breathtaking sunset views overlooking the golf course and pond from this meticulously maintained and thoughtfully updated 5-bedroom, 3.5-bath home. Perfectly positioned to capture panoramic views of the 17th hole, this home offers a stunning backdrop from dawn to dusk, with walls of windows filling the interior with abundant natural light. Brazilian cherry hardwood floors span the main level, where soaring vaulted ceilings and a dramatic double staircase create a grand first impression. Designed for both everyday living and entertaining, the main floor features a spacious kitchen, formal dining room, private office, reading room, laundry room, and convenient half bath. Step outside to the expansive deck with maintenance-free aluminum railings--an ideal place to relax and take in the spectacular sunset views over the water and fairway. Upstairs, you'll find four bedrooms, including a generous primary ensuite with large double closets and an updated bath featuring quartz countertops. The newly finished daylight lower level expands your living space with a family room, rec room, additional bedroom with walk-in closet, full bath, and abundant storage. Pride of ownership shines throughout with numerous updates, including several newer Jeld-Wen windows and a furnace and A/C just 3 years old, roof was replaced in 2015. Additional highlights include a large 3-stall garage and exceptional storage and underground sprinkling.
